Transaction 0262320f3246bc19d74d86031932fb1abd0852460db024d58e3197dce52991e4

1 Input
2 Outputs
  • 0262320f3246bc19d74d86031932fb1abd0852460db024d58e3197dce52991e4:0
  • value  1670935
    address  3NxEfo5HHMMhgZk33sLHKtdLW7smav9ERm
  • 0262320f3246bc19d74d86031932fb1abd0852460db024d58e3197dce52991e4:1
  • value  30903929
    address  1MtZaJRtEhyr2fCM9MTL8X5ASvEq6jBAW4